Real estate transactions are being executed in an environment where “technical” risks increasingly determine commercial outcomes. Indirect tax and transfer-tax exposures can materially change deal economics when a transaction is structured or documented in a way that later triggers reclassification, VAT leakage, or disputes with tax authorities. At the same time, legal and regulatory complexity, title and encumbrance issues, zoning and permitting constraints, lease and landlord–tenant liabilities and compliance requirements can translate into closing delays, price adjustments, or post-completion claims if not surfaced early through disciplined, transaction-oriented due diligence.
